>> > With respect to your second point on referring to the canonical
location
>> > http://www.w2.org/2001/xml.xsd, I like to bring your attention to the
>> > following excerpt from that schema:
>> >
>> >  <xs:annotation>
>> >   <xs:documentation>In keeping with the XML Schema WG's standard
>> versioning
>> >    policy, this schema document will persist at
>> >    http://www.w3.org/2001/03/xml.xsd.
>> >    At the date of issue it can also be found at
>> >    http://www.w3.org/2001/xml.xsd.
>> >    The schema document at that URI may however change in the future,
>> >    in order to remain compatible with the latest version of XML Schema
>> >    itself.  In other words, if the XML Schema namespace changes, the
>> version
>> >    of this document at
>> >    http://www.w3.org/2001/xml.xsd will change
>> >    accordingly; the version at
>> >    http://www.w3.org/2001/03/xml.xsd will not change.
>> >   </xs:documentation>
>> >  </xs:annotation>
>> >
>> > I think we should set the xsi:schemaLocation for the xml namespace to
>> > http://www.w3.org/2001/03/xml.xsd.

>> >>According to the XML namespace standard [1],
>> >>The prefix xml is by definition bound to the namespace name
>> >>http://www.w3.org/XML/1998/namespace.
>> >>So the declaration is not required, but it might not be illegal to have
>> >>it.  I suggest *not* putting it, since it would cause folks to look
>> >>twice and wonder if the prefix is being bound to it's non-default
>> >>value.  And it's easier to point buggy software to the URL that shows
>> >>them where they're non-compliant. :)
>> >>
>> >>Also, according to the same spec [2]
>> >>Prefixes beginning with the three-letter sequence x, m, l, in
>> >>any case combination, are reserved for use by XML and
>> >>XML-related specifications.
>> >>
>> >>It's not clear if defining The "xml" prefix to have its official value
>> >>is allowed. :)
